欧亚民 發表於 2023-9-24 00:00:00

DEDECMS后台登陆空白排查错误原因

<p>
        DEDECMS后台登录出现空白页的情况,此时由于没有错误提示,无法进行排查调试,按照下面的方法打开真实报错之后即可看到如下图的真实报错</p>
<p align="center">
        <img style="max-width:100%!important;height:auto!important;"title="DEDECMS后台登陆空白排查错误原因" alt="DEDECMS后台登陆空白排查错误原因" align="" src="https://zhuji.jb51.net/uploads/img/202305/186617751c62f4e3b3c4245501f7465e.jpg"></p>
<p>
        后台登录空白一般情况下是程序的异常,可以通过配置开启程序真实错误信息来进行问题定位,方法如下:</p>
<p>
        1、找到:include/common.inc.php文件打开,</p>
<p>
        2、查找程序代码://error_reporting(E_ALL);error_reporting(E_ALL || ~E_NOTICE);</p>
<p>
        替换为:error_reporting(E_ALL);//error_reporting(E_ALL || ~E_NOTICE);</p>
<p>
        这一步很重要,因为它会告诉我们为什么变成空白的提示信息,</p>
<p>
        3、保存之后再次进入管理后台,这个时候会发现后台会有一句话提示了</p>
<p>
        错误提示是:Parse error: syntax error, unexpected ‘:’ in/data/home/hyu1509xxxxx/htdocs/include/helpers/string.helper.phpon line309</p>
<p>
        4、之后排查修改掉程序的错误就行了,错误修改完成之后以上的修改还原回来就行了</p>
頁: [1]
查看完整版本: DEDECMS后台登陆空白排查错误原因